Flowers, Fairies and Butterflies

I saw this challenge on the Greeting Farms Blog Farm Fresh Friday - Fluttery Floral and just had to give it a try.                                 Awhile back my friend Elena sent me some stamped images from the Greeting Farm and one of them was this adorable Fairy called, (Fairy Eva) and I thought she was perfect for this challenge.                                             For your card you had to use flowers, and at least one butterfly.  I had this great paper (DCWV) that had butterflies on it and thought it was perfect for this challenge.
My card baseis Pixie Pink layered with Apricot Appeal and the Butterfly DP from Die Cuts with a View. I also added a small piece of Pretty in Pink embossed with the Floral Fantasy embossing folder and my Cuttlebug.  I added a lacy border in Pixie Pink that I punched with a Martha Stewart Punch and stitched with my Janome Sew Mini.  The sentiment was stamped with Pumpkin Pie ink and is from the Greeting Farm set, (McSplended Farm).  I colored Fairy Eva with Prisma Color pencils and blended her with Gamsol.  Then I added some Crystal Glitter (Art Institute) to her wings and layered her to Pixie Pink cs with my Nesties. 
My flower is a combination of a Daisy Doodle Silk flower and some punched flowers (SU-retired).  I added brads (Queen and Co.) and Pumpkin Pie Grosgrain ribbon and some punched butterflies (source unknown) to complete my card.
